GSL at 25: A legacy of transformative experiences

By: Laura Klaum

Sunday, August 10, 2025

Faculty and Alumni celebrate 25 years of Global Service Learning Photo by Drew Lees

Becoming a more compassionate provider. Building connections with communities and colleagues. Making a real difference in people’s lives. Having a lasting impact. Planting seeds.

While 25 years is certainly a meaningful milestone, these reflections from global service-learning (GSL) participants point to something deeper: the transformation that occurs in IU School of Dentistry (IUSD) students because of these trips.

When people hear about GSL, they often think of philanthropic dental services, an enduring and important program outcome. But what distinguishes the program from typical healthcare service trips are its hallmarks: community collaboration and professional growth. Students return not only with tangible clinical and academic experiences, but with expanded cultural competence, leadership skills, and a global perspective that shapes the kind of providers—and people—they become.

“GSL has opened doors for students to serve and learn in settings around the world—and strengthened our school’s reputation as a leader in global dental education,” said Dr. Angeles Martinez Mier, associate dean of global engagement.

On Friday, August 8, 2025, more than 100 guests—traveling from across Indiana and other states including Texas, Ohio, Utah, and North Carolina—gathered at IU Indianapolis to celebrate this legacy. They heard from Dean Carol Anne Murdoch-Kinch, program co-founder Dr. Tim Carlson, and current GSL program director Dr. Jeffrey Steele. Throughout the evening, as participants enjoyed international cuisine, 25 years of photos offered a visual lens into the program’s 123 previous trips representing nine countries and 24 separate GSL locations.

“The goal of tonight’s celebration is to honor the achievements of our GSL program, re-establish connections with GSL alumni, and recognize the faculty, staff, and partners who make this program possible,” Martinez Mier said.

“This is a night that should ignite emotions and memories—a program that gives our life purpose,” Steele added.  

The event’s turnout reflected the enthusiasm and commitment of a growing GSL community—more than 1,000 students and 51 faculty or alumni members. A few attendees joined Dr. Steele in sharing travel tales and personal stories of change inspired by these trips.

Among those who spoke was alumnus Dr. Jeff Jones (DDS ’08), who took an alternative spring break trip to Hidalgo, Mexico, as a student—an experience that moved him so much, he went two additional times.

“We’re all good stewards with our profession, and we can give back,” Jones said. “Dental health is one of the largest problems causing disease throughout the world, and there’s a massive need. My trip was impactful enough to send me on this path.”

Jones began traveling to Honduras annually in 2014 and later started a foundation to assist with fundraising. He now travels accompanied by his wife, Lissi, and their children, as well as with four IUSD classmates who also participated in the Mexico GSL program. His children are old enough to assist with sterilization during their trips, and he believes they walk away from trips being better people.

Dr. Dino Dieudonne (DDS ’19), whose GSL experiences took him to Haiti and Ecuador, believes the trips have the power to transform people’s perspectives.

“Students think about dental careers and earning potential. These trips put everything in perspective,” Dieudonne said. “We take for granted many things living in the U.S.—whether it’s food, roads, running water, electricity, or air conditioning. These are things many do not have. On these trips, you learn a little about contentment, a little bit about patience. You learn to be gracious, and to extend that grace to others.”

These anecdotes are just a small representation of the program’s powerful legacy. Event name badges included flags representing countries visited, and as the evening progressed, participants matched flags and reminisced together about their travels and the program’s impact. Twenty-five years of their collective stories, and many more still to come, are a milestone truly worth celebrating.
